Interactive University Project

The Seismological Laboratory is collaborating with a number of UC Berkeley Departments and Organized Research Units to coordinate the campus education and outreach activities and to develop an information infrastructure to improve the delivery of these services. The Interactive University Project attempts to integrate these campus efforts. The Berkeley Seismological Laboratory participated in phases I and II of this project.

In order to foster a diverse approach to education and outreach through "information infrastructure", The Interactive University Project sponsored a number of pilot projects. At UC Berkeley, the Berkeley Seismological Laboratory, the Center for Particle Astrophysics, the Center for EUV Astrophysics, and the Museum of Paleontology combined forces to create the ISTAT Project - Integrating Science, Teaching, and Technology.

From 1996-1998, we worked with several schools in the Oakland and San Francisco Unified School Districts:

As part of this project, we developed an ISTAT Resources in Seismology Web Page and the first of many Digital Curriculum guides. When the ISTAT Project received continued funding under a three-year IUP Community Learning grant, we continued working with 4 schools:

As part of this project, we also developed an Earth Science scope and sequence for the 9th grade, which includes course outlines, curriculum resources and a monthly feature (last updated March 2002) called Earth Science in the News. The ISTAT project held several workshops in the San Francisco Unified School District in order to introduce this material to the 9th grade science teachers.
